Description

The General Services Administration (GSA) is seeking to lease office space in Bloomington, Indiana, as the current lease is set to expire. The desired office space should range from 930 to 985 square feet, must be contiguous, and include two parking spaces, while adhering to specific government standards for fire safety, accessibility, and sustainability, and not being located within a floodplain area. This procurement is crucial for maintaining government operations in the region, as the GSA will evaluate alternative spaces based on economic viability, including relocation costs and potential downtime.
